: A common professional secret for a "fluffy" bed is to overstuff the duvet cover by using an insert that is one size larger than the cover itself.
: Before adding sheets, use a pillow top mattress cover . This adds an immediate layer of visible plushness and protects the mattress long-term. : For a mature look, do not simply pull the duvet to the top of the bed. Instead, fold the duvet down about a third of the way and roll the ends to create a visible, thick layer that highlights the different bedding textures. mature on bed spreading
